By: Barron Murdoch It has been many years since checking accounts are making movement around. In earlier days, a letter of credit was issued to the customer by their trusted bank and was permitted to write their check based on that. It was really a convenient option for those who want to travel a lot without carrying hard cash with them. Same is the principal nowadays too. You first deposit money in your bank and they offer you the blank checks that allow you to withdraw money from your account. |

In the United States, cheques are governed by Article 3 of the Uniform Commercial Code. - An order check – the most common form in the United States – is payable only to the named payee or his or her endorsee, as it usually contains the language "Pay to the order of (name)."
